What to Expect from Home Automation System Installers

Working with professional home automation system installers is very different from buying off-the-shelf devices or leaving technology to chance during construction. A good installer follows a process that ensures your home or business is wired, programmed, and supported for long-term success.

Here’s what you should expect:

  • Consultation & Planning Your installer begins by understanding your lifestyle and property needs—whether that’s a family home, a vacation retreat, or a business space. This stage defines how automation will support comfort, security, energy efficiency, and entertainment.

  • System Design Next comes detailed planning: where wiring should be run, how lighting will layer into scenes, how AV equipment integrates with security, and how everything ties together into one control ecosystem.

  • Professional Installation Structured wiring, network configuration, and device setup are handled with precision—coordinating with electricians, HVAC, and other trades so nothing is missed.

  • Integration & Programming Unlike plug-and-play gadgets, systems are programmed to work together. Motion sensors trigger lights, shading adapts to sunlight, HVAC responds automatically, and entertainment flows room to room.

  • Training & Support After installation, you should expect clear training on how to use your system, plus ongoing support to keep everything up-to-date and reliable.

The best home automation system installers act not just as technicians, but as long-term technology partners—designing systems that grow with your needs instead of becoming outdated.


Choosing the Right Home Automation System Installers

Not all home automation system installers are the same. Some come from an AV background, focusing on audio and video integration with automation as an afterthought. Others take an automation-first approach, designing meaningful ecosystems where lighting, climate, shading, energy, and entertainment all work together in harmony. Knowing the difference is key.

Here are qualities to look for in the right installer:

  • Ecosystem Focus vs. Gadget Focus An AV-first installer may connect your speakers and TV, but a true automation partner will unify every system—lighting, HVAC, security, shading, audio, and energy—into one intelligent platform.

  • Design Sensitivity Great installers balance performance with aesthetics. They think about how switches, sensors, and speakers integrate into the architecture and interior design, not just how they function.

  • Scalability & Future-Proofing Look for installers who think ahead. Structured wiring, robust networking, and flexible system design allow your automation to grow with your home or business needs.

  • Problem-Solving & Critical Thinking The best teams don’t just follow manuals. They troubleshoot unusual electronics, adapt to unexpected challenges, and even engineer custom solutions when required—making sure everything works together exactly as intended.

  • Ongoing Support A quality installer is a long-term technology partner, not a one-time contractor. Look for teams who provide ongoing service, updates, and system care well beyond installation day.

By choosing installers who prioritize ecosystems, design, adaptability, and long-term support, you ensure your investment delivers not just automation, but meaningful intelligence for your home or business.

We know what you might be thinking: all of this sounds complicated, overwhelming, or costly. But here’s the truth—when automation is designed and planned the right way, it feels effortless. The complexity stays hidden behind the walls; all you notice is how smoothly your home or business runs.

The key is timing. If automation is considered early—before demolition begins or before walls are sealed—it becomes part of the foundation, just like electrical or plumbing. Wait until the last minute, and you’re forced into rushed decisions, compromises, and workarounds that often end up costing far more. Cutting corners is always the most expensive choice.
